It combines an infrared LED and a phototransistor in one package. The LED emits infrared light toward nearby surfaces. The phototransistor then detects any light that bounces back. As a result, the sensor can tell when an object is close.<\/p>\n<h3 id=\"how-the-tcrt5000-infrared-sensor-works\" class=\"code-line\" dir=\"auto\" data-line=\"17\">How the TCRT5000 Infrared Sensor Works<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"19\">The TCRT5000 infrared sensor works on reflection, not transmission. First, the IR LED emits light. Next, that light hits a nearby surface. If the surface reflects light, the phototransistor detects it. Consequently, the output current changes to signal detection.<\/p>\n<h2 id=\"key-features-of-the-tcrt5000-infrared-sensor\" class=\"code-line\" dir=\"auto\" data-line=\"21\">Key Features<\/h2>\n<p class=\"code-line\" dir=\"auto\" data-line=\"23\">The TCRT5000 offers several practical advantages for embedded designs.<\/p>\n<ul class=\"code-line\" dir=\"auto\" data-line=\"25\">\n<li class=\"code-line\" dir=\"auto\" data-line=\"25\"><strong>Compact package.<\/strong>\u00a0The sensor fits into small PCBs easily.<\/li>\n<li class=\"code-line\" dir=\"auto\" data-line=\"26\"><strong>Low cost.<\/strong>\u00a0It suits high-volume production runs.<\/li>\n<li class=\"code-line\" dir=\"auto\" data-line=\"27\"><strong>Fast response.<\/strong>\u00a0It detects fast-moving objects reliably.<\/li>\n<li class=\"code-line\" dir=\"auto\" data-line=\"28\"><strong>Simple interface.<\/strong>\u00a0It needs only basic analog or digital wiring.<\/li>\n<\/ul>\n<h3 id=\"tcrt5000-infrared-sensor-detection-range-and-limitations\" class=\"code-line\" dir=\"auto\" data-line=\"30\">TCRT5000 Infrared Sensor Detection Range and Limitations<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"32\">The TCRT5000 works best at short range. Typical detection range runs from 2mm to 15mm. Therefore, it isn&#8217;t suitable for long-distance sensing. Also, ambient light can affect its readings.<\/p>\n<h2 id=\"tcrt5000-infrared-sensor-technical-specifications\" class=\"code-line\" dir=\"auto\" data-line=\"34\">Technical Specifications<\/h2>\n<table class=\"code-line\" dir=\"auto\" data-line=\"36\">\n<thead class=\"code-line\" dir=\"auto\" data-line=\"36\">\n<tr class=\"code-line\" dir=\"auto\" data-line=\"36\">\n<th><strong>Parameter<\/strong><\/th>\n<th><strong>Symbol<\/strong><\/th>\n<th><strong>Range<\/strong><\/th>\n<th><strong>Unit<\/strong><\/th>\n<th><strong>Notes<\/strong><\/th>\n<\/tr>\n<\/thead>\n<tbody class=\"code-line\" dir=\"auto\" data-line=\"38\">\n<tr class=\"code-line\" dir=\"auto\" data-line=\"38\">\n<td>Forward voltage (LED)<\/td>\n<td>V_F<\/td>\n<td>1.1\u20131.5<\/td>\n<td>V<\/td>\n<td>Typical at 20mA<\/td>\n<\/tr>\n<tr class=\"code-line\" dir=\"auto\" data-line=\"39\">\n<td>Peak wavelength<\/td>\n<td>\u03bb_p<\/td>\n<td>~950<\/td>\n<td>nm<\/td>\n<td>Infrared spectrum<\/td>\n<\/tr>\n<tr class=\"code-line\" dir=\"auto\" data-line=\"40\">\n<td>Collector current<\/td>\n<td>I_C<\/td>\n<td>1\u201330<\/td>\n<td>mA<\/td>\n<td>Phototransistor output<\/td>\n<\/tr>\n<tr class=\"code-line\" dir=\"auto\" data-line=\"41\">\n<td>Operating temperature<\/td>\n<td>T_op<\/td>\n<td>-25 to 85<\/td>\n<td>\u00b0C<\/td>\n<td>Standard range<\/td>\n<\/tr>\n<tr class=\"code-line\" dir=\"auto\" data-line=\"42\">\n<td>Detection distance<\/td>\n<td>D<\/td>\n<td>2\u201315<\/td>\n<td>mm<\/td>\n<td>Optimal range<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p class=\"code-line\" dir=\"auto\" data-line=\"44\">These specs guide circuit design decisions directly. For example, designers size the LED resistor using V_F. In addition, they set pull-up resistors based on I_C. Always confirm exact values against the manufacturer&#8217;s datasheet before finalizing a design.<\/p>\n<h3 id=\"wiring-the-tcrt5000-infrared-sensor\" class=\"code-line\" dir=\"auto\" data-line=\"46\">Wiring the TCRT5000 Infrared Sensor<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"48\">Wiring the TCRT5000 requires four pins. First, connect the LED anode to power through a resistor. Second, connect the LED cathode to ground. Third, connect the phototransistor collector to a pull-up resistor. Finally, connect the emitter to ground.<\/p>\n<div>When integrating the TCRT5000 into a detection circuit, following proper <a href=\"https:\/\/blogs.lcsc.com\/blog\/electrical-circuit-design-the-engineers-guide-to-components-specs-layout\/\">electrical circuit design<\/a> practices helps improve signal stability and sensing accuracy.<\/div>\n<h2 id=\"common-tcrt5000-infrared-sensor-application-scenarios\" class=\"code-line\" dir=\"auto\" data-line=\"50\">Application Scenarios<\/h2>\n<p class=\"code-line\" dir=\"auto\" data-line=\"52\">The TCRT5000 fits many practical use cases.<\/p>\n<ul class=\"code-line\" dir=\"auto\" data-line=\"54\">\n<li class=\"code-line\" dir=\"auto\" data-line=\"54\"><strong>Line-following robots.<\/strong>\u00a0The sensor detects dark and light surfaces. Robots use this contrast for path tracking.<\/li>\n<li class=\"code-line\" dir=\"auto\" data-line=\"55\"><strong>Object counting.<\/strong>\u00a0The sensor detects items on a conveyor. Each interruption triggers a count.<\/li>\n<li class=\"code-line\" dir=\"auto\" data-line=\"56\"><strong>Tachometers.<\/strong>\u00a0The sensor detects a rotating slotted wheel. This setup measures motor speed accurately.<\/li>\n<li class=\"code-line\" dir=\"auto\" data-line=\"57\"><strong>Proximity switches.<\/strong>\u00a0The sensor triggers when objects get close. This works well in vending machines.<\/li>\n<\/ul>\n<h3 id=\"avoiding-ambient-light-interference\" class=\"code-line\" dir=\"auto\" data-line=\"59\">Avoiding Ambient Light Interference<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"61\">Ambient light can cause false readings in the TCRT5000 infrared sensor. Therefore, shield the sensor from direct sunlight. Also, use comparator circuits with adjustable thresholds. This approach improves reliability outdoors.<\/p>\n<h2 id=\"tcrt5000-infrared-sensor-manufacturing-and-procurement-notes\" class=\"code-line\" dir=\"auto\" data-line=\"63\">Manufacturing and Procurement Notes<\/h2>\n<p class=\"code-line\" dir=\"auto\" data-line=\"65\">The TCRT5000 infrared sensor comes from established IC manufacturers, including Vishay and similar suppliers. However, choose the Sharp sensor instead for longer distances.<\/p>\n<div>For custom sensor boards, good <a href=\"https:\/\/blogs.lcsc.com\/blog\/qfn-pcb-layout-guide\/\">PCB layout<\/a> practices can reduce noise and improve the performance of infrared sensing circuits.<\/div>\n<h2 id=\"frequently-asked-questions\" class=\"code-line\" dir=\"auto\" data-line=\"78\">Frequently Asked Questions<\/h2>\n<h3 id=\"how-do-i-calculate-the-led-resistor-value\" class=\"code-line\" dir=\"auto\" data-line=\"80\">How Do I Calculate the LED Resistor Value?<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"82\">Use Ohm&#8217;s law with supply voltage and V_F. First, subtract V_F from the supply voltage. Then, divide the result by your desired current.<\/p>\n<h3 id=\"does-the-tcrt5000-infrared-sensor-follow-industry-standards\" class=\"code-line\" dir=\"auto\" data-line=\"84\">Does the TCRT5000 Follow Industry Standards?<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"86\">It follows standard optoelectronic component specs. However, no specific international standard applies to this part.<\/p>\n<h3 id=\"is-the-tcrt5000-infrared-sensor-reliable-in-dusty-environments\" class=\"code-line\" dir=\"auto\" data-line=\"88\">Is the TCRT5000 Reliable in Dusty Environments?<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"90\">Dust can reduce reflection accuracy over time. Therefore, enclosures help maintain consistent performance.<\/p>\n<h3 id=\"is-the-tcrt5000-cheaper-than-ultrasonic-sensors\" class=\"code-line\" dir=\"auto\" data-line=\"92\">Is the TCRT5000 Cheaper Than Ultrasonic Sensors?<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"94\">Yes, it costs less than most ultrasonic modules. However, ultrasonic sensors offer a longer detection range.<\/p>\n<h3 id=\"can-i-use-the-tcrt5000-infrared-sensor-outdoors\" class=\"code-line\" dir=\"auto\" data-line=\"96\">Can I Use the TCRT5000 Infrared Sensor Outdoors?<\/h3>\n<p class=\"code-line\" dir=\"auto\" data-line=\"98\">Yes, but shield it from direct sunlight. Otherwise, ambient IR light can cause detection errors.<\/p>\n<h2 id=\"find-what-you-need-on-lcsc\" class=\"code-line\" dir=\"auto\" data-line=\"100\">Find What You Need on <a href=\"https:\/\/www.lcsc.com\/\">LCSC<\/a><\/h2>\n<p class=\"code-line\" dir=\"auto\" data-line=\"102\">Finding the right TCRT5000 infrared sensor is easy on\u00a0LCSC.
